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Practical Metal Finishing - Most frequently, metal polishing is essential for aesthetic reasons or clean-room application. It's one of the more favored solutions due to its use in intensifying the overall beauty of the product, such as, kitchenware, auto parts or motorcycle parts. Equally, plenty of clean-rooms will require a shiny finish in an effort to decrease the penetrability of the components which could result in particles to gather and contaminate. An excellent illustration of this use would be in vacuum chambers. There exist a great number of approaches to finish metal, and let us take a look at a number of the processes required. Metal can be polished utilizing chemicals,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, or even by hand. A finishing compound or paste may be utilized, that may include lim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, fairly high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time intensive. In contrast, merchandise made of non-ferrous metal are definitely more receptive to polishing, as these demand the minimum number of procedures.
Any time a superior processing quality is simply not essential, faster pad speeds should be considered. A lesser pad speed is commonly employed if a top quality m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s coated in compound will be significantly affected by the forces on the surface of the polish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be accelerated to a definite limit, having said that, going beyond the perfect amount of force not simply lowers the quality level of the procedure, but also worsens efficiency, may well cause wear on the part, and there's also an obvious overheating of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When you are working on thin items, it is increased heat (and the resultant pliability of the material) that causes parts to buckle, distort or twist. In general, it will take a highly trained polisher to take into account each one of these elements to both avert damage to the metal part and to give good results effectively. In order to significantly improve the quality of the resultant surface, the buffing action needs to be executed with significantly less aggression and not as much force to be able to eventually deliver a surface with no scratches or fine lines brought about by the polishing process, thus 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
